Output 2ca3b903c815e569e5577d319977a278e97f63dc37f2b9a33b645b7952abca77:4

value
4089407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99bf1859068b59af2681afffb1b6820c1e50a290 OP_EQUAL
address
3FhxER1LuD62Aed8p84eGt8DP54X3ZVkum
transaction
2ca3b903c815e569e5577d319977a278e97f63dc37f2b9a33b645b7952abca77
spent
true